Veiled Writer
 

 

Short Biography

Veiled Writer was born and raised Muslim on the east coast of the United States.

Like other second and third generation Muslims growing up in the US, finding her way between the looming iniquities beckoning and heeding to the path outlined in Islam has been a difficult but rewarding journey.

Writing started as a pass time that soon turned into a full fledge love affair. Veiled Writer started a newsletter for young Muslim girls in her community at the age 15 and created a support group for young Muslim women who wear the Islamic face veil at 18.

Now, married and a mother of one, Veiled Writer, is a student and is currently working on completing her first urban Islamic novel and Islamic poetry collection.

Veiled Writer is the former Assist. Director of IWA, and also served as website designer and webmistress for a period of time. Her short stories and poetry can be found on many Muslim E-zine sites and print magazines. She also performs her poetry readings live at Muslim women events. Currently, she is busy finishing up her first poetry chapbook and novel, Inshallah.
